meta: Add TCOVERRIDE for toolchain selection at recipe scope
TCOVERRIDE is defined to toolchain-<TOOLCHAIN> and its added to OVERRIDES that a recipe can see and it can use "toolchain-gcc" or "toolchain-clang" to set specific metadata based upon global distro toolchain policy.
